On-call notes for the Ledgerloom inventory reconciliation job. Runs nightly at 02:10. If it stalls past 45 minutes, kill the worker and restart from the Tallygate console. Restart requires re-auth as the recon service account. Password auth is disabled for that account; recovery is the only path. Do not guess retries — three failures lock the account for an hour. To recover, open the Tallygate recovery prompt and enter the exact passphrase that follows.

unlock words, yawig-kagef: gordor-holvan-ulaael-pramir-ulaiel-tamdor

Q: How do I get keys for the pool cars? A: The key cabinet is in the Marlbeck Hall mailroom, left of the parcel shelves. Book the car first in the fleet calendar, then collect the tagged key and sign the ledger. The cabinet keypad accepts the current monthly code, listed below.

door code, tahop-fahap: bdg-JZCXMY-37375484

**Ticket #4471 — EXIF scrubber skips rotated JPEGs**

Heads up, future folks: the Pixwipe scrubber in Lanternbox misses GPS tags when the image has an orientation flag of 6 or 8.

Repro:
1. Upload `beach.jpg` shot in portrait mode.
2. Run the scrub job via the admin panel.
3. Download the result and inspect metadata — GPS block still there.

Likely the rotation pass re-writes EXIF after scrubbing. Swap the pipeline order in `pixwipe/rotate.go`.

To repro against staging, call the scrub endpoint with the token below.

login token, bagug-kafop: eyJhbGciOiJIUzI1NiIsInR5cCI6IkpXVCJ9.eyJzdWIiOiIcMLov2In0.Z5RLDIfp